专业级解压软件精准解析百种压缩算法

1942920 苹果软件 2025-03-11 3 0
在数字化进程加速的今天,数据压缩技术已成为信息存储与传输的基石。从科研机构的基因序列分析到互联网企业的用户日志处理,压缩算法在提升存储效率和降低传输成本方面发挥着不可替代的作用。专业级解压软件作为数据处理的终端环节,其精准解析能力直接决定着数据资产的完整性与可用性。当前市场上主流的WinRAR、7-Zip等工具仅支持30余种常见压缩格式,而新一代专业解压工具通过深度算法解析,突破性地实现了对LZMA2、Zstandard、Brotli等百余种压缩算法的精准支持,在医疗影像处理、卫星遥感数据解析等专业领域展现出独特价值。

一、技术实现原理

专业级解压软件精准解析百种压缩算法

专业解压软件的核心突破在于构建了模块化的算法解析框架。该架构采用分层设计理念,底层通过抽象接口定义通用解压规范,上层则针对不同算法实现具体解码模块。例如在处理LZ77衍生算法时,软件通过动态码表重建技术,可精准还原霍夫曼编码树结构;在应对Bzip2的Burrows-Wheeler变换时,则采用反向排列算法确保数据还原准确性。 斯坦福大学计算机实验室2023年的研究表明,这种模块化设计使软件具备算法热插拔能力。当新型压缩算法如Facebook的Zstandard 1.5版本发布时,开发者只需编写对应模块即可实现兼容,无需重构核心架构。这种技术特性使得专业解压软件能够持续跟踪前沿压缩技术发展,目前已完成对量子压缩算法QZIP的实验室级支持。

二、应用场景拓展

专业级解压软件精准解析百种压缩算法

在金融数据处理领域,专业解压软件展现出独特优势。高频交易系统产生的tick数据通常采用Delta编码与LZ4混合压缩,传统工具难以处理毫秒级时间戳的精准还原。某华尔街量化基金实测数据显示,专业软件在解压NASDAQ Level2市场数据时,将错误率从0.03%降至0.0001%,同时处理速度提升40%。 科研领域的数据解压需求更具挑战性。欧洲核子研究中心(CERN)的粒子对撞实验数据采用自定义压缩格式ECMA-404,其嵌套式数据结构对解压工具提出严苛要求。专业软件通过实现JSON-LD规范解析器,成功将50TB实验数据的解析时间从72小时缩短至9小时,助力科学家更快获得实验结果。

三、安全防护机制

压缩包已成为恶意软件传播的主要载体之一。卡巴斯基2024年安全报告指出,32%的勒索病毒通过伪装成正常压缩文件传播。专业解压软件构建了多层防御体系:在预处理阶段采用熵值分析法检测异常压缩率,对加密压缩包实施沙箱隔离;在解压过程中实时监控文件行为特征,成功拦截了包括Cerber 4.0在内的新型勒索病毒。 针对APT攻击常用的隐写术,软件研发团队与密码学专家合作开发了深度检测模型。该模型通过分析DEFLATE算法压缩流中的统计特征,可识别出隐藏信息的存在概率。在DARPA组织的网络安全挑战赛中,该技术帮助参赛团队在300GB测试数据中准确找出所有隐写文件,检测精度达到99.7%。

四、性能优化策略

内存管理优化是提升解压效率的关键。专业软件采用分层缓存机制,将高频访问的字典数据保留在L3缓存,低频数据置换至虚拟内存。英特尔实验室测试显示,在处理100GB以上的Zstd压缩包时,该策略使内存命中率提升65%,解压速度提高2.3倍。同时引入的NUMA架构感知技术,有效减少了跨节点内存访问带来的延迟。 多核并行处理方面,软件实现了任务级别的动态负载均衡。通过实时监测各CPU核心的队列深度,智能分配LZMA2解码任务。在AMD EPYC 9754处理器上解压4K视频素材时,32核利用率达到98%,相较传统解压工具提升40%的吞吐量。这种优化对影视特效行业处理REDCODE RAW格式素材具有重要价值。 在数字化浪潮持续深化的当下,专业解压软件的创新突破具有显著的现实意义。其技术架构的扩展性设计为应对未来数据爆炸提供了可靠保障,安全防护机制的完善则筑牢了数字经济的安全防线。随着边缘计算和物联网设备普及,如何实现资源受限环境下的高效解压将成为新的研究重点。建议行业关注神经网络压缩算法的解码优化,并探索FPGA硬件加速在实时解压场景中的应用,这些方向的发展将进一步提升数据处理的效率与可靠性。